About Annulment Law in Damascus, Syria:

Annulment is a legal procedure that declares a marriage null and void. In Damascus, Syria, annulment is governed by local laws that dictate the grounds for annulment, the process for filing a petition, and the requirements for obtaining an annulment.

Local Laws Overview:

In Damascus, Syria, the grounds for annulment may include fraud, coercion, inability to consummate the marriage, or lack of parental consent. The annulment process involves filing a petition with the family court, providing evidence to support your claim, and attending court hearings. It is essential to understand the specific requirements and legal procedures in Damascus, Syria, to navigate the annulment process successfully.
